#1efd2e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1efd2e is composed of 11.8% red, 99.2% green and 18%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 88.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 81.8% yellow and 0.8% black. It has a hue angle of 124.3 degrees, a saturation of 98.2% and a lightness of 55.5%. #1efd2e color hex could be obtained by blending #3cff5c with #00fb00. Closest websafe color is: #33ff33.

Shades and Tints of #1efd2e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000801 is the darkest color, while #f4fff5 is the lightest one.
